WebNormally, light chains are produced in humans at about 500 mg/day. Although approximately twice as much κ as λ is produced, renal clearance of the larger, dimeric λ light chains is slower, causing the normal κ:λ ratio to be about 0.58 (range 0.26–1.65 mg/L, median serum κ level of 7.3 mg/L, median serum λ of 12.7 mg/L) . WebOnce set, light chain class remains fixed for the life of the B lymphocyte. In a healthy individual, the total kappa-to-lambda ratio is roughly 2:1 in serum (measuring intact whole antibodies) or 1:1.5 if measuring free light chains, with a highly divergent ratio indicative of neoplasm.
